Publication number: 20140263143Abstract: A lifting system for semiconductor processing equipment utilized in a cleanroom environment. The lifting system comprises of an articulating arm, a base, a load indicator, a capture tool and a wirelessly controlled hoist motor unit with float control. The float control allows precise positioning and movement of the load without requiring use of up and down controls of the wireless remote. Covers and the bellows positioned on and coupled with the arm assembly reduce contamination caused by a wire rope extending from the arm. A load indicator shows the system coming under load while holding the load stationary. A capture tool provides quick release and ease of grabbing the load with the use of a capture pin. A rotary electrical collector provides a full 360 degrees of rotation of the articulating arm from the base, in both directions. Patent number: 8447252Abstract: An approach and apparatus for adaptive scanning for detection and classification of an RF signal. Time-domain and frequency-domain information are acquired and processed over a broad band of frequencies segmented into channels to produce signal features. The signal features are classified using a signal classifier into signal discriminants, from which a signal of interest is located and identified.
